Jean Louis wrote:
>>> (cond ((file-directory-p file) (expand-file-name file))
>>> (t nil))
>>
>> (when (file-directory-p file)
>> (expand-file-name file) )
>
> I am aware of it, I prefer using `cond' as I get
> more clarity.
The (t nil) part is of no use, even if you stick to `cond'.
"If no clause succeeds, cond returns nil."
And: one COND, one branch or BODY - in idiomatic Lisp, that's
`when'.
